Olympia Dairy Closure: A Region Grapples wiht Loss and Uncertainty


The Shockwaves of Shutdown: Olympia Milk factory Closes its doors

The recent proclamation of the olympia Milk factory’s closure in Herfelingen has sent ripples of shock and dismay throughout the Pajottenland region. The closure, resulting in the loss of 168 jobs, marks a meaningful blow too the local economy and a profound sense of loss for the community.

A “Black Day” for Pajottenland: Local leaders Express Regret

Kris Poelaert, the Mayor of Pajottegem, described the impending closure as a black day for the whole of Pajottenland, highlighting the deep connection between the dairy and the region’s identity. the sentiment is echoed by manny who view the factory as more than just a business; it’s a symbol of their heritage and agricultural roots.

Failed Takeover Attempts: The End of the Line for Olympia

The Dutch company chocovit’s decision to close the Olympia factory comes after a failed takeover attempt. This closure highlights the challenges faced by traditional industries in a rapidly changing economic landscape.The 168 jobs lost represent a significant blow to the local workforce, particularly in a region heavily reliant on agriculture and related industries.
